WHO WE ARE

WHO WE ARE

The core family at UbiK media is made up of people who combine solid scientific training with over 15 years of experience in communication for R&D&I.

We are a multilingual team (Spanish, Catalan, English and French) with experience in both traditional and digital media.

One of the things we most enjoy is taking on the challenges of our clients as if they were our own.

STRATEGIC TEAM

EVA LOSTE

With a PhD in Inorganic Chemistry from the University of London, Eva has worked in the field of scientific communication since 2003. She has extensive experience working on communications for projects and research centres and creating scientific and cultural activities. She spent four years as a scriptwriter and casting director for the Spanish television programme Redes. In 2006 she took the post of executive director for El cerebro social, a centre aimed at informing the general public about social neuroscience. In 2008 she was hired as Head of Communication for the Educational Technology Department at the UOC (Open University of Catalonia). She works regularly works on educational magazines and training courses. In 2011 she set up her own science communication agency, UbiK media, which she has been directing ever since.

SILVIA BRAVO

With a PhD in particle physics from the Autonomous University of Barcelona, Silvia has worked in the field of science communication since 2001. She worked as an editor for the Spanish television programme Redes and has curated exhibitions for the Terrassa Museum of Science and Technology, “la Caixa” Foundation and the Regional Government of Catalonia. She was head of communications at the eLearn Centre at the UOC and the Catalan Institute of Palaeontology, and worked freelance for the Institute of High Energy Physics. In 2013 she joined the University of Wisconsin-Madison, where she managed communications for the IceCube Neutrino Observatory and coordinated an international network of 50 collaborating institutions. She joined UbiK media in 2018 as an expert in strategic communication and social media management.
